Frequently Asked Questions about Des Moines

What type of rentals are currently available in Des Moines?

There are currently 1298 Apartments for Rent in Des Moines, IA with pricing that ranges from $380 to $16,429. There are also 217 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Des Moines ranging from $380 to $4,000.

What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Des Moines?

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Des Moines ranges from $380 to $4,000 with an average monthly rent of $1,829.

How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Des Moines?

For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Des Moines range from $685 to $4,100,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$1,000 to $2,875.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$1,495 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$500.
